Modifying the core software program of an Android gadget, referred to as rooting, historically concerned sacrificing the flexibility to obtain official over-the-air (OTA) updates. It is because rooting typically includes unlocking the bootloader, altering system recordsdata, and putting in customized recoveries, that are processes that may battle with the official replace mechanisms pushed out by producers. The first purpose of rooting is to realize elevated privileges, permitting customers to customise their units past the constraints set by the producer. Traditionally, this trade-off between customization and replace availability was a major concern for a lot of customers.
Sustaining entry to updates after rooting is essential for a number of causes. Updates typically embrace safety patches that defend the gadget from vulnerabilities, efficiency enhancements that improve the person expertise, and new options that reach the gadget’s performance. Dropping the flexibility to obtain these updates leaves the gadget uncovered to dangers and doubtlessly limits its lifespan. Prior to now, the selection between a rooted gadget and a safe, up-to-date gadget was a tough one, forcing customers to weigh the advantages of customization towards the dangers of obsolescence and safety breaches.
